Scientist Richard Dawkins has announced a new live UK tour which includes a date in Cambridge.

Dawkins – arguably, one of the most respected scientists and thinkers of our time, is to embark on a new tour of the USA and Europe. 

The world-renowned evolutionary biologist and best-selling author of such landmark books as The Selfish Gene, The God Delusion and Unweaving The Rainbow have earned him millions of admirers through his passion for the wonders of science and the vital importance of reason.

He now takes to the road later this year with An Evening With Richard Dawkins and Friends which visits the Cambridge Corn Exchange on Tuesday, October 29.

Renowned for his unapologetic advocacy of science and reason, Dawkins is celebrated for ground-breaking work that captivates millions with his passion for scientific inquiry.

In his new tour – which begins in the USA in September, before heading to the UK and Europe – Dawkins and a number of special guests will connect with audiences in unscripted conversations touching on topics from science to religion, life on earth and beyond.

Audiences will hear first-hand about forthcoming book – The Genetic Book of the Dead – in which Dawkins delves into the transformative potential of DNA in our understanding of evolution.
